Canada`s hydrobromic acid import trend showed significant growth from 2023 to 2024, with a growth rate of 36.47%. The compound annual growth rate (CAGR) for the period 2020-2024 was 5.16%. This uptrend can be attributed to increased demand from various industries, indicating a positive import momentum and market stability during this period.

In Canada, the hydrobromic acid market is regulated by several government policies aimed at ensuring safety, environmental protection, and compliance with industry standards. The main regulatory bodies overseeing this market include Health Canada, the Canadian Environmental Protection Act (CEPA), and the Workplace Hazardous Materials Information System (WHMIS). Health Canada regulates the use of hydrobromic acid in products intended for human consumption or contact to ensure they meet safety standards. CEPA focuses on the environmental impact of substances like hydrobromic acid and sets limits on their use to protect ecosystems. WHMIS mandates labeling and safety data sheets for hazardous materials, including hydrobromic acid, to ensure workplace safety. Overall, these policies work together to maintain the safe handling and use of hydrobromic acid in Canada.
